Vietnam’s April steel imports, exports diverge
In April this year, Vietnam’s exports of iron and steel grew while imports dropped significantly compared with March, but both remained higher on a year-on-year basis, Kallanish learns from monthly data released by the Vietnam Customs.
April steel exports from Vietnam amounted to 973,549 tonnes, up 11.4% month-on-month and just 0.2% y-o-y. The average realised price also hiked 5.9% from March to $835/tonne, but was 20% lower from the year-ago level.
